Leggett Creek Campground sits at 3,640 feet where Leggett Creek meets the South Fork of the Clearwater River near Elk City. The five sites accommodate RVs and trailers, with vault toilets and fire rings. Access is most reliable in summer, though the remote location means you'll need to pack out all trash and store food carefully due to bear activity.

Weather and SeasonsSummer brings 70–85°F daytime temperatures and long hours for fishing and exploring nearby trails. Water levels drop from spring runoff by midsummer, leaving clearer pools and better wading conditions. Weekends draw moderate crowds, but midweek is quiet. Winter snow can block access, and spring runoff swells the rivers.

Natural Features and SceneryThe campground occupies a valley where Leggett Creek flows into the South Fork of the Clearwater River. Evergreens line the banks, and the convergence creates pools and riffles that attract anglers. Mountains frame the valley in every direction. Wildlife is active here: squirrels are common around camp, and bears visit frequently enough that multiple reviewers mention encounters.
